Comparison of European recommendations about patient blood management in postpartum haemorrhage
Abstract Postpartum haemorrhage (PPH) is the leading cause of maternal mortality and morbidity worldwide. Some documents with practical recommendations for the management of PPH do not include the most updated directives. This review offers a quality comparison of the recommendations stated in Europe since 2015.

Laparoscopic distal pancreatectomy (LDP) was compared with open distal pancreatectomy (ODP) in a randomized trial. LDP was associated with shorter hospital stay, enhanced functional recovery, and less bleeding than ODP.
